Kartell Maui Chair

Designed between 1995 and 1996, the original Maui Chair was the focal point of design research in the nineties and was the first of a new era of single mould seats that had no ribbing, metal supports or reinforcements to support the back. The perfect chair for home or commercial environment.

Designed By

Vico Magistretti was an Italian industrial designer, known as a furniture designer and architect. A collaborator of humanist architect Ernesto Nathan Rogers, one of Magistretti's first projects was the "poetic" round church in the experimental Milan neighborhood of QT8.
